BUCKTOWN — A cellist duo and group of Chinese line dancers will each perform hour-long shows Tuesday in Bucktown, as part of the worldwide 'Make Music' event that's held annually on the Summer Solstice — the longest day of the year.

Described in a listing as playing classical music, with some folk, Latin American and jazz mixed in, the Cellenium Ensemble will perform from 4-5 p.m. Tuesday in Senior Citizens Memorial Park, at 2228 N. Oakley Ave.

"The 168 Fitness team," a group of line dancers who exercise to Chinese pop music, will perform line dances from 7-8 p.m.

Senior Citizens Memorial Park is just north of the Holstein Park pool and field house.

In the event of rain, the shows will move to "a sheltered place," organizers say.
